Spring Door Basket
Monday, March 1, 2004

Supplies:

  • 1 Tulip Bush
  • Greenery or flowering vine
  • 1 Pansy bush
  • Foam
  • Moss
  • Wall basket or container
Instructions:

 1.
Glue foam in container.

 2.
Cover foam with moss.

 3.
Use 3, 5 or odd number of tulips, insert in middle back of the container. Make sure to put a nice curve on some of the tulip stems so that they face a variety of directions.


 4.
Cut greenery apart and place it in the front of the tulips around the edge of the container.

 5.
Place the pansy bunch in the front of the daisies and just off center.

 6.
You can embellish with a bird's nest or bird, butterfly, even dried pods for that early spring transitional look. Also change elements such as hyacinth instead if pansies, or daffodils instead of tulips. Yeah, it's almost Spring and the real thing will be everywhere ! Have fun, DAZ.
